In celebration of the 30th anniversary of the founding of the Madres of Plaza de Mayo, the premier human rights organization in Latin America, The MBIDE has arranged for a visit to the US by The MPM, headed by the Madres' President, Ms. Hebe de Bonafini and the Executive Director of the University of the Madres, Mr. Sergio Shocklender. The visit has been scheduled for January 20-30, 2007. If you're interested in scheduling an appearance by the Madres at your school, please let me know just as soon as you can.
